Hon. Alabi, Ibadan pride in NASS- Balogun

……as lawmaker gifts Olubadan power generating set.

The lawmaker representing Egbeda/Ona-Ara Federal Constituency in the House of Representatives, Abuja, Hon. Akin Alabi has been described as an Ibadan pride in the green chamber by the immediate past Senator of Oyo South Senatorial District, Dr. Sen. Kola Balogun.

Dr. Balogun, the Baba-Kekere Olubadan spoke on behalf of the Olubadan of Ibadanland, Oba Sen. Lekan Balogun, CFR, Alli Okunmade II at the presentation of a 20KVA Mikano power generating set to the palace by the lawmaker, who is also the Mogaji Ajiogbo family of Labiran area in Ibadan hinterland on Saturday.

In a press statement made available to journalists in Ibadan by the Personal Assistant on Media to the Olubadan, Oladele Ogunsola, Sen. Balogun recalled that the potential of the lawmaker as a star became manifest right at the orientation programme organized for the newly elected members of the National Assembly (NASS) in 2019 when he too was elected a Senator. 

According to him, “Hon. Alabi right away at the orientation programme organized for all the lawmakers in 2019, Senators and House of Representatives members, he showed the stuff he was made and proved himself one of our stars. To those of us, who knew him before, we were not surprised. Since then, he has remained a very good ambassador of the state.

“I’m sure the members of his constituency can attest to the fact that he’s a performing lawmaker. Ibadan too can say so and I’m saying it that he is a pride. He has been a very good son to His Imperial Majesty ever before becoming what he’s today and personally, I’m not surprised. We can only pray for him to continue to soar like an eagle”, Sen. Balogun added.

Asking him to remain himself and committed to the good works he has been doing, the Baba-Kekere Olubadan insisted that “any lawmaker, who is from Ibadan that fails in giving good representation in the National Assembly does not only fail his or her constituents, the person also fails Olubadan, who was there before all of us as a Senator”.

In his brief remark, the lawmaker disclosed that the presentation was a fulfilment of the promise made about two weeks ago during his Christmas visit to the Olubadan, noting that he’s not always at ease whenever he makes a promise until such is fulfilled, expressing gladness that the promise he made about two weeks ago has been kept. 

The Chairman, House Committee on Works corroborated the submission by Sen. Balogun that he’s a son to the Olubadan, recalling that the present Olubadan was the one God used for him to become Mogaji in 2016. “Truly, I’m a member of the house and I promise to remain so. Kabiyesi is my father and it is my prayer that he lives long to see us making more exploits in all fronts”.
